The Mirialan, Chiss, and Rattataki social abilities (Focusing Ritual, Mission Review, and Shadowbox respectively) are regen abilities, same as Recharge and Reload, Meditation, Channel Hatred, and regen items. You may notice that if you use them, your health and resource rapidly regens at the same rate as if you used your "normal" regen ability or a regen item. All except for BHs, which is the bug being discussed here.
